IVY’S RESERVE SOMERSET RED is a mature “aged cheddar” (aged over 12 months). You can see it’s crumbly. It has a mouthwatering edge of sharpness and a lot of umami with a lovely orange red color. While in the cheddar family this is specifically “Red Leicester” which is similar too but more crumbly than cheddar.

“Crafted in the style of a Red Leicester, Ivy’s Red is a special edition among Wyke Farm’s variety of Cheddars. It definitely stands out for its burnt-orange color and nutty & fruity notes, which are delivered with a firm texture that is rich, creamy, a bit tangy”

It’s a farm cheese, produced at Wyke’s Farm in Somerset, England. The label for Ivy’s Reserve Somerset Red describes it as “nutty, mellow & moreish,” More-ish is a British term that means, “having a very pleasant taste and making you want to eat more.”
